BOYS’ SOCCER WEEK ONE RANKINGS: Corbin remains on top, keep an eye on much-improved Whitley County squad

L4 Security 13th Region Media Network

Boys Soccer Top 5

1. Corbin (0-2 overall)

The Redhounds have gotten off to a very slow start (outscored 8-0) but are winners of 14 straight against regional opponents. Until they lose a regional game, they’re going to remain as the team to beat.

2. North Laurel (1-2-1)

The Jaguars are young and talented but took one on the chin Saturday, losing to Madison Southern, 8-1,

Six different players have scored for North Laurel this season with Jackson McCowan leading the way with three goals.

3. South Laurel (1-2-1)

It’s really hard to gage how our teams are this season with the slow start each have gotten off to.

The Cardinals handled Barbourville with ease, winning 9-0, before dropping a 1-0 decision to Southwestern on Saturday.

Liam Zik leads the Cardinals with three goals while Eli Buckles has two.

4. Whitley County (2-1)

It might be time to take the Colonels as serious contenders for the region. Coach Michael Branham has done a wonderful job building the program, and now gets a shot to see just how good they are with  the Class 2A, Section 2 Tournament coming up. 

Matthew Sawyers has totaled nine goals and five assists for Whitley County while Johnny Parra has four goals, and eight assists.

5. Middlesboro (0-0)

The Yellow Jackets haven’t played a game yet but keep an eye on them this season.
